ecomm.design features and specs

  • Comprehensive Directory
    eComm.design provides an extensive directory of e-commerce websites, showcasing a wide variety of design styles, which can be an invaluable resource for designers looking for inspiration or benchmarking.
  • Detailed Filters
    The website offers robust filtering options to browse e-commerce sites by platform, industry, design elements, or features, making it easy to find specific types of sites and design ideas.
  • Design Inspiration
    eComm.design serves as a great source of inspiration for designers and developers by curating a selection of aesthetically pleasing and functionally effective e-commerce sites.
  • User Experience Focus
    By focusing on the user experience aspect of e-commerce sites, eComm.design helps highlight best practices and innovative approaches in UX design.

Possible disadvantages of ecomm.design

  • Limited Content Scope
    The website focuses primarily on e-commerce design, which might limit its usefulness for those looking for resources and inspiration outside of this niche.
  • Potential Outdated Examples
    Depending on how frequently the directory is updated, some examples of e-commerce sites might feature outdated design trends or technologies.
  • Design-Only Focus
    eComm.design emphasizes visual design aspects and may not provide enough insight into the technical implementation or business aspects of running an e-commerce site.

DevLogs features and specs

  • Community Engagement
    DevLogs offers a platform for developers to engage with a community, where they can receive feedback and support on their projects.
  • Documentation
    By maintaining DevLogs, developers can create a comprehensive record of their development process, which can be useful for future reference and learning.
  • Accountability
    Regularly updating a DevLog can help developers stay accountable to their goals and timelines, encouraging consistent progress.
  • Skill Improvement
    Writing about their work can help developers communicate their ideas more clearly, aiding personal skill improvement in technical writing and storytelling.

Possible disadvantages of DevLogs

  • Time-Consuming
    Maintaining a DevLog requires a significant time investment, which can detract from the time available for actual development work.
  • Privacy Concerns
    Developers may have to be cautious about what they share publicly, as sensitive information or project details could be inadvertently disclosed.
  • Pressure to Entertain
    Developers might feel pressured to create engaging content for their audience, potentially shifting focus from genuine progress to content creation.
  • Overcomplexity
    Some developers might find DevLogs to be overly complex or difficult to maintain, especially if they prefer simple documentation methods.
